Tom Aspinall is thinking about Jon Jones.

For over a year, Aspinel sat on the bystander waiting for a battle that would never come. Instead of signing the dotted line for the much-anticipated heavyweight unification collision, “Bone” chose to abandon his belt.

By then, the UFC had already promoted Aspinall from the interim to the indisputable champions and began working on setting up his first title defense. On October 25th, Aspinall will place gold on the line for the first time against Ciryl Gane at UFC 321 in Abu Dhabi.

Jones jumped straight back into the test pool and began asking if anyone could immediately see the “bone” and aspinel squares.

According to Aspinall, the answer is simple.

Tom Aspinel is not interested in fighting John Jones in the White House 😬

“And you don’t have any interest in it. And the world should not be interested either.

πŸŽ₯ @ariywanipic.twitter.com/1wk2h4obha

– Championship Round (@champrds) August 11, 2025

“A companion who is not interested,” Aspinel told Ariel Helwani during his battle with John Jones. “And don’t even have any interest in the world, because what is the point? Just a false hope.”

Tom Aspinall doesn’t think about anything other than Ciryl Gane

Instead, Aspinall will focus on defeating “Bongamine” at Etihad Arina this fall.

“I’m already in the fight, so I’m focusing on that. … For the next 10 weeks of my life, all I’m thinking is Ciryl Gane and how to beat him,” Aspinall said.

Aspinall was 8-1 under the UFC banner and his only loss occurred in July 2022 through an unusual injury in the first 15 seconds scheduled scrap with Curtis Blaydes.
